I think that for realism mode, there should be more realistic gathering. That means mining, woodcutting etc. Right now, you hit with a pickaxe like you are using a Charger arm and taking steroids. It should be slowed down somewhat.
Woodcutting would have the same principles. Look at the MineColony mod's lumberjack's cutting speed to see how fast it could go.
Efficiency could also be changed. Now that you're no longer on steroids, it would take painstakingly long to mine. So, let's say mining and woodcutting would have better efficiency to make up for lack off speed, once again, MineColony is a good representation.
You can chop down a tree in less than an hour in real time.
It takes a few seconds in minecraft because a Minecraftian Day is significantly shorter than a real day.
At 20 minutes long from sunrise to sunrise, a Regular Day is 72 times longer than a Minecraftian Day. That means every Minecraftian hour is roughly 1.2 real time minutes, assuming my math is correct.
